About Richlandtown, PA

Richlandtown is a city in Pennsylvania, located in Bucks County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 1,453 residents. It is a middle-aged city, with a median age of 41 years.

Economically, Richlandtown is a middle-income community. The median household income of $82,778 is near the national average. Approximately 6.5%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 3.5%, below the national average.

The real estate market in Richlandtown is a mid-range housing market. Median home values stand at $315,500, which is near the national average. Renters typically pay around $1,375 per month. Homeownership is high at 74.5%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Richlandtown is moderately educated. 33.3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— near the national average. The community is primarily White (90.23%).
